Council approves zoning ordinances, bond issuance and multiple committee recommendations in omnibus votes

Berkeley County Council · December 9, 2025

Summary

Berkeley County Council approved several zoning map changes (bills 25-48, 25-49, 25-57), advanced multiple first- and second-reading ordinances, authorized bond issuance (bill 25-58) and approved committee recommendations including the Camp Hall sewer stub funded by Santee Cooper and vehicle replacements and grants.

Berkeley County Council conducted multiple readings and approved a slate of ordinances and committee recommendations during the meeting.

Third readings: Council approved zoning and map-change ordinances including bill 25-48, bill 25-49 and bill 25-57 by voice vote. The council also approved bill 25-58, authorizing the issuance and sale of general-obligation bonds not to exceed $40,000,000 for county projects as presented.
